
The Hamilton Tiger-Cats announced today that the football club has signed American offensive linemen Darrin Paulo and Bryson Broadway.
Paulo, 28, has previously spent time with the NFL’s Detroit Lions, Denver Broncos and New Orleans Saints, in addition to stints with the UFL’s Memphis Showboats and USFL’s Tampa Bay Bandits.
Prior to turning pro, the 6-5, 315-pound native of Sacramento, California, played four seasons at Utah (2016-19), where he suited up in 53 games and earned first-team Pac-12 All-Conference honours in his senior season.
Broadway, 23, spent the last two seasons at Georgia Southern (2023-24) after previously playing at Georgia State (2022) and Eastern Illinois (2020-21). The 6-5, 290-pound native of Dawsonville, Georgia received second-team All-Sun Belt Conference recognition with Georgia Southern in 2024.
